Gwent Police received a call just prior to 8pm regarding a two-vehicle collision. No one was hurt.
Commuters experienced delays during evening rush hour on the M4 in the Newport area due to an accident located between junction 27 High Cross and junction 26 Malpas.
Significant traffic buildup began appearing just after 5.20pm on Tuesday, April 21, with vehicles moving slowly in both directions along the eastbound lanes. All lanes stayed open.
Traffic monitoring systems and real-time maps indicated wait times of approximately 15 minutes during the busiest part of the evening commute as vehicles traveled past the location. Traffic began returning to normal levels after 6.30pm, with the backlog nearly gone by just after 7pm when regular driving conditions returned.
The situation was resolved later that evening after the motorway was completely clear and the disruption came to an end.
